
Maharashtra ministers get offices in Mantralaya complex
MUMBAI [Maha Media]: Ministers in the Devendra Fadnavis government in Maharashtra were allocated offices in Mantralaya, the state secretariat in south Mumbai, on Monday.
Senior ministers Chandrashekhar Bawankule, Radhakrishna Vikhe Patil, Hasan Mushrif, Chandrakant Patil, Girish Mahajan and Ganesh Naik were allocated chambers in the annexe building in the complex, while Mangal Prabhat Lodha and Pankaja Munde will have their offices in the main building, officials said.
Ministers of State Meghana Bordikar, Indranil Naik and Yogesh Kadam have been given offices on temporary basis at Vidhan Bhavan, the legislature complex nearby.
